SAUCE

Fashion store €€

The first Hindi boutique in Dubai created in reaction to the rampant standardization of fashion and clothing tastes, this brand, which the founders insist on writing with a star (S*uce), has paved the way for many others today. Like Colette in Paris, the store is multi-brand, presenting the creations of the regional hype-generation alongside a few pieces taken from Europe: Tata Naka, Ashish, Studd, Dice Kayek, Vanessa Bruno, Jean-Charles de Castelbajac, See by Chloe. The website is great for online shopping.

KORABA

Jewelry and watches €€

If there is one jewelry shop in Dubai that is not to be missed, it is Koraba, famous for its amber. The Emiratis love it! With a first boutique opened in 2006 and a name that is still original, the brand now offers a wide range of elegant and refined jewellery, for young and old alike. Indeed, amber, which takes its name from the Arabic word anbar, is known to reduce teething in infants. The result of exceptional craftsmanship, Koraba jewellery is well worth a visit to one of the shops.

VASHU

Fabrics haberdashery and wool

It's almost like "Au bonheur des Dames". It's a veritable two-storey cave, selling every conceivable type of fabric for clothing: printed, plain, in every color and price range. Don't hesitate to call the mobile number if you have a pattern to copy. The store manager will direct you to a dressmaker who can reproduce your design. The whole area is full of fabric merchants, and you shouldn't hesitate to push open the doors to discover real treasures.

SOUK AL KABEER

Fabrics haberdashery and wool

The old souk finds its natural place on the banks of the Creek, at the heart of the maritime trade, where local merchants would display their products to exporters in a row. Built in length and surmounted by a high openwork wooden arch frame, it protects from direct sunlight, but allows daylight to filter through, giving it a subdued atmosphere conducive to strolling. One should not hesitate to go also behind the Dubai Museum opposite the souk, in the more modern alleys to find a large number of cloth merchants.

BAMBAH

Boutique mode femme €€€

It all started with a second-hand vintage store in the Jumeirah district. Maha Rasheed, of Egyptian origin, passionate about the style of the 50s, was a great success. She has since set up her own store in City Walk, which is a hit. Bambah, whose name means "rose" in Arabic, is inspired by the actresses of the Egyptian cinema of the 50s and offers a collection where polka dots, floral patterns, long sleeves and a fitted waist are in the spotlight. Popular with customers in the Gulf, Bambah combines modernity and vintage.

DRAGON MART

Shopping mall

Outside of China, it is almost the largest place where you can find, grouped together in the same space, so many products from the Middle Kingdom! One would think that Dubai, like many other cities, needed its Chinatown. And there are chinese shops: textiles, decoration, household appliances, handicrafts, costume jewellery, household linen and all kinds of gadgets and you can bargain. It will take you more than a day to see everything over several thousand square kilometres. You can find everything in this huge dragon-shaped mall !

KULTURE HOUSE

Concept stores €€

It is in a villa in the Jumeirah district that this concept store is installed, which is also a space for exhibitions and a café where many people who telework come. In a heterogeneous decor, composed of superimposed wallpapers and paintings from every corner of the globe, one finds a multitude of decorative objects and crafts mainly from Morocco. The café serves dishes largely inspired by Mediterranean cuisine. An address mostly frequented by expatriates in the neighbourhood.
